Deliver a rich, coherent RE course at KS3 and equip pupils with a deep understanding of religion with ready-made, flexible and high quality KS3 lessons from Collins.

‘Knowing Religion’ is written by an author team of experienced RE teachers and led by series editor Robert Orme of West London Free School.

• Discover the history and beliefs of Buddhism, Hinduism and Sikhism as well as these religions in the modern world

• Start teaching straight away with Teacher Guide resources available on Collins Connect, including teaching ideas and support along with answers to questions in the student books

• Give pupils the grounding they need to excel at GCSE RS

• Ignite an interest in religion through a compelling narrative, fascinating facts and extraordinary people

• Aid pupil memory with a ‘knowledge organiser’ at the end of each unit covering key vocabulary, people, places, and dates

• Spark discussion and assess understanding with questions for each lesson including longer-form discursive questions to provide extended writing and essay practice

• Each book structured as 16 lessons to offer flexibility and map onto the school timetable with ease

• The ‘Knowing Religion’ series also includes resources on Christianity, Judaism and Islam
